time-tested combination of indicators In order to help make market messages or calls, Williams uses his very own time-tested mix of fundamentals, seasonal trends, technical signals and intelligence learned from the Commitment of Traders report from the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C). Here is the way he considers about the 3 sorts of roles the CFTC accounts. Williams considers positioning by professional traders or hedgers and users and manufacturers of commodities to be the smart dollars. He considers sizeable traders, mainly big investment shops, as well as the public are actually contrarian signals.

Count on an extended stock market selloff to be able to produce promote phone calls in September, Williams turns to what he calls the Machu Picchu trade, as he discovered the signal while going to the early Inca ruins with his wife in 2014. Williams, who’s intensely focused on seasonal patterns that always play out over time, realized that it is usually a great strategy to sell stocks – making use of indexes, largely – on the seventh trading day before the conclusion of September. (This season, that is Sept. 22.) Selling on this day time has netted net profit in short-term trades 100 % of the moment over the past twenty two years.
